新型随钻堵漏钻井液体系的研制

摘    要:针对平方王油田钻井过程中钻井液漏失的难题,研制了一种新型多功能随钻堵漏钻井液体系。介绍了新型随钻堵漏钻井液体系的配方优选,探讨了该体系的最佳流变性能、防塌抑制性和悬浮稳定性,研究了该体系的承压能力和封堵能力。实验结果表明,该体系具有较强的抗温抗污染能力,悬浮稳定性好,密度调节范围广,封堵填充加固能力强,具有常规钻井液及随钻堵漏钻井液的性能特点,易操作、可调整。

Development of new-type drilling fluid system for lost circulation while drilling

Abstract:To deal with the severe drilling fluid leakage difficulty while drilling in Pingfangwang oilfield, a new-type multi-functional drilling fluid system for lost circulation while drilling was developed. Formulation of this system was optimized and evaluated. The optimal rheolo-gy, anti-sloughing inhibition and suspended stability of the system were discussed. Finally, pressurized and plugging capabilities were studied. The testing result shows that this system has obvious temperature- and contamination-resistant capability, good suspended stability and wider density adjusting range, strong plugging filling reinforce ability. It has both the properties of normal drilling fluid and drilling fluid for lost-circulation while drilling, with easy operation and adjustment.
